Sacred Geometry - Tutorial and interpretations
Sacred geometry isn't really sacred. It is a term that has been given to various geometrical representations of commonly occurring mathematical relationships in nature, and it is these relationships that pervade through music, cosmology, geometry and even physics. Our ancestors had come to observe and learn of these geometrical instances and it has usually been described and defined in terms of spiritual and divine allusions, often influencing decisions such as the construction of holy buildings and interpretation of events. And it was because of this association with nature and the divine that it came to be known as sacred geometry.

You are undoubtedly familiar with certain aspects of sacred geometry, such as the Golden Ratio, Da Vinci's "Proportions of the Human Body", Fibonacci Spiral, Platonic Solids, the Star of David, fractals and of course the Pyramids. Then there are the lesser known facets, such as toroids, numerical representations in the Zodiac, clocks, the Last Supper and even the derivation of the shapes of the Hebrew Alphabets.

It is the recurring nature and pervasiveness of sacred geometrical concepts that they are often associated with spiritualistic principles, such as the creation of the Universe as I shall show you in this article. Such interpretations are understandably the product of personal convictions and depend upon an individual's view of the universe, but exploring this would go beyond the scope of this article. The point is, there is much to explore in this field as it is a natural component of mathematics. The reason that very little analysis has been performed on this is due to the New Age associations that it has now come to be considered an integral part of, although this is an ignorant misconception that many people like to hold.

In this article, I will show you how to create various sacred geometry objects, specifically the vesica piscis, the Egg of Life, the Flower of Life, the Fruit of Life, the Tree of Life and then using these to derive the five Platonic Solids. Along the way, I shall be associating a Universal Creation story along with the initial progression of the geometry, merely to demonstrate how these simple concepts can give rise to spiritual interpretations, although these do not reflect my personal beliefs.

You can do this yourself if you have a compass to draw circles with and a pencil. Or, if you have a graphics software such as Adobe Photoshop or Corel/Jasc Paintshop Pro. I used Adobe Photoshop owing to the fact that I am a programmer and therefore have lost the knowledge of the usage of a pencil.

To begin with, draw a two-dimensional representation of the three spatial axes, X, Y and Z. In actuality, the sacred geometry derivations occur in the three dimensional space. However, for the sake of simplicity, we represent it in two dimensions as that is the form we are most comfortable with.

The Platonic solids have been known since antiquity although it was the Greeks who studied it in detail. Plato called them the 'perfect solids', as they were the most aesthetically beautiful and and symmetrical. The criteria for a Platonic solid is that all their edges be equal, that there only be on regular polygonal surface with one angle, and that the points all fit on the surface of a sphere. There are exactly five known Platonic solids: the cube, the tetrahedron, the octahedron, the dodecahedron and the icosahedron. By systematically eliminating some of the lines from the Metatron's Cube, you can derive these solids.

Metatron's Cube

The image you see above is the correct version of "Metatron’s Cube", or the fruit of life with the 5 platonic solids. I made it with a 3D program and what you see are the actual edges of the platonic solids.

The dodecahedron and icosahedron actually have their "inner" corner points touching the star tetrahedron that fits in a circle that is = 1/Ø x the circle connecting the corners of the outer cube.


Where Ø ("phi") = 1.618 033 988 749 594 ...

The way to figure out drawing this is by beginning with the normal flower of life "grid" (of 5 non-intersecting inner circles, or in this case: 7 intersecting full circles - left image):

Then draw a circle that is equal to 1/Ø x the outer circle.


For this, put the point of a compass on the middle of the vertical radius (in the centre of the second "flower" from the top along the vertical axis) and draw a circle from where the horizontal axis (through the middle of the circle) cuts the outer circle (see below);
The circle you can draw when you put one point of the compass in the centre of the grid, and draw a circle from where the other circle cuts the vertical axis (through the middle of the circle), is a circle Ø times smaller than the outer circle:

After this, draw the appropriate startetrahedron(s) and you have found all the points necessary to draw the other platonic solids.
